A rare opportunity to buy a vintage watch with the K2071 29 jewel automatic movement, regarded as one of the finest ever made. 18 carat gold case, the 0,750 mark in case back is the modern notation for this, see image.

Only about 800 watches with this movement are thought to ever been produced by Audemars Piguet. 
Movement number has been dated at AP as 1963. The case is 1953 as AP provenance shows the third movement.

The movement's diameter is 29 mm and it is 6.3 mm in height (from previous owner's spec). The beat rate is 18,000 bph.
Case diameter not including crown 35 mm, lug to lug 41 mm.

The K2071 caliber is a rare, high-quality automatic watch movement made by Jaeger-LeCoultre exclusively for Audemars Piguet in the late 1950s and 1960s, designed to rival top-tier movements like those from Patek Philippe, featuring an 18k gold rotor, 29 jewels, and used in sought-after vintage AP dress watches, often retailed by stores like Türler. 
Key Characteristics:
  • Manufacturer: Jaeger-LeCoultre (JLC).
  • Usage: Primarily by Audemars Piguet (AP) in vintage timepieces.
  • Type: Self-winding (automatic).
  • Jewels: 29.Seller added: Ruby rollers.
  • Rotor: 18k gold weighted rotor.
  • Significance: Considered one of the best automatic movements of its era, competing with high-end Pateks.
  • Rarity: Produced in limited quantities, making it a collector's item. 
Associated Watches:
  • Often found in Audemars Piguet dress watches, such as the reference 3123BA, which were sometimes oversized for the period (around 36mm) and retailed by prestigious jewelers like Türler.
